/**
Print at a specific location on the screen.
This function will move the cursor to a given screen location, print the specified string,
and return the cursor to the original locaiton.
If -1 is specified for either the Row or Col the current screen location for BOTH
will be used and the cursor's position will not be moved back to an original location.
if either Row or Col is out of range for the current console, then ASSERT
if Format is NULL, then ASSERT
In addition to the standard %-based flags as supported by UefiLib Print() this supports
the following additional flags:
%N - Set output attribute to normal
%H - Set output attribute to highlight
%E - Set output attribute to error
%B - Set output attribute to blue color
%V - Set output attribute to green color
Note: The background color is controlled by the shell command cls.
@param[in] Row the row to print at
@param[in] Col the column to print at
@param[in] HiiFormatStringId the format string Id for getting from Hii
@param[in] HiiFormatHandle the format string Handle for getting from Hii
@return the number of characters printed to the screen
**/
UINTN
EFIAPI
ShellPrintHiiEx(
IN INT32 Col OPTIONAL,
IN INT32 Row OPTIONAL,
IN CONST EFI_STRING_ID HiiFormatStringId,
IN CONST EFI_HANDLE HiiFormatHandle,
...
);
